Product Description
| Model Type |
YS710M-132 |
YS720M-132 |
YS730M-132 |
YS740M-132 |
YS750M-132 |
| Rated Maximum Power at STC |
710W |
720W |
730W |
740W |
750W |
| Maximum Power Voltage (Vmp) |
40.48V |
40.86V |
41.04V |
41.34V |
41.52V |
| Maximum Power Current (Imp) |
17.54A |
17.62A |
17.78A |
17.9A |
18.06A |
| Open Circuit Voltage (Voc) |
45.55V |
45.85V |
46.15V |
46.45V |
46.75V |
| Short Circuit Current (Isc) |
18.45A |
18.54A |
18.66A |
18.79A |
18.92A |
| Module Efficiency |
22.85% |
23.17% |
23.5% |
23.82% |
24.14% |
| Working Conditions |
| Operating Temperature |
-40°c~+85°c |
| Maximum System Voltage |
DC 1000V(IEC) / 1500V(IEC) |
| Maximum Series Fuse |
25A |
| Power Tolerance |
0~+5W |
| Temperature Coefficient of Pmax |
-0.35%/°c |
| Temperature Coefficient of Voc |
-0.29%/°c |
| Temperature Coefficient of Isc |
+0.048%/°c |
STC (Standard Testing Conditions): Irradiance 1000W/m², Cell Temperature 25 °C, Spectra at AM1.5
NOCT (Nominal Operating Cell Temperature): Irradiance 800W/m², Ambient Temperature 20 °C, Spectra at AM1.5, Wind at 1 m/S
Frequently Asked Questions
What are the primary benefits of 700W+ solar modules?
700W+ solar modules utilize advanced large-format cells (such as N-type TOPCon or HJT) to yield higher power output per panel. This efficiency substantially reduces the Balance of System (BOS) costs, including racking, cabling, and installation labor, while maximizing energy generation in limited spaces.
What configuration options exist for the protective glass?
The modules offer flexible glass configurations based on application requirements, including standard 3.2mm tempered glass for monofacial modules, or 2+2mm dual-glass structures for bifacial modules, enhancing durability and mechanical performance.
What level of weather protection do the junction boxes offer?
The junction boxes feature an IP 68 waterproof rating coupled with an innovative full-glue-filled design. This provides optimal protection against dust, water ingress, and extreme weather, guaranteeing long-term operational safety.
Are these solar modules compatible with standard mounting accessories?
Yes. Standard 35mm and 40mm anodized aluminum frames ensure compatibility with mainstream mounting and tracking systems. They also feature MC4 compatible connectors with a 500N tensile strength for reliable electrical hookups.
How do temperature coefficients impact the output of these modules?
With a temperature coefficient of Pmax at -0.35%/°C, these modules experience less power degradation under high ambient temperatures, making them highly efficient for projects located in hot and sunny climates.
What is the standard warranty period for these high-power modules?
These modules typically come with a 12-year standard product warranty on materials and workmanship, alongside a 25-to-30-year linear power output warranty, ensuring long-term yield and security for your investment.
